International News Lesotho Group Meeting A meet and greet meeting to further Scouting Irelands International involvement in future overseas projects.Our chief guest was the Wife to the Ambassador of Lesotho and Director of Action Aid Mrs Moipone Phamotse and Mary Eastwood Deputy Director of BNI(Business Network International) A wide discussion of our aspirations and the needs of Scouting in Lesotho. Darragh O Brian (Project facilitator and team lead)stated that this was a huge step closer to identify a partner country and a direct link to groups and schools on the ground that have varying needs depending on their geographical locations.The team will now review the meeting and map out their plans going forward,

Reykjavík Peace Þing The Icelandic Boy and Girl Scout Association invites Scouts and Guides from your association to participate in our international Reykjavík Peace Þing*. It will take place in Iceland October 12th – 14th 2012. The Icelandic Scouts celebrate the Centenary of Scouting in Iceland this year. Many events are scheduled throughout the year to celebrate the Centenary and the Peace Þing is one of the major events. The goal of the Peace Þing is to encourage individuals to actively participate in creating peace. We want to show actively how the Scout Method can be used to create peace. With the Peace Þing, we want to promote people’s ideas about peace. The 25 lectures on offer focus on the idea of peace in its most diverse form, as well as 5 workshops that will show participants how to include peace in their lives. The Peace Þing is open to all who would like to contribute to creating peace and prosperity in the world.

The main focus is to join together people from all over the world that are working with peace, thinking about peace or want to inspire and get inspired by peace whether Scouts, Guides, teachers, educators or other peace-minded individuals.
